What is the Telc B1 Certificate?
The acronym "Telc" stands for The European Language Certificates. Telc GmbH is a globally recognized screening body that offers language examinations in various languages, lined up with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).

At the B1 level, a prospect is expected to understand the main points of clear, standard input on familiar matters frequently experienced in work, school, and leisure. The certificate proves that the individual can deal with a lot of scenarios most likely to develop while traveling in a location where the language is spoken and can produce simple linked text on topics of personal interest.

The Telc B1 test is divided into 2 primary parts: a composed evaluation and an oral evaluation. The written portion is designed to evaluate receptive and productive skills through reading, listening, and composing, while the oral part evaluates the ability to communicate in real-time.
1. The Written Examination
The composed examination lasts around 150 minutes (2.5 hours) and is structured as follows:
SectionElementPeriodObjectiveReadingChecking out Comprehension & & Language Elements90 minutesComprehending primary concepts, information, and grammar/vocabulary in context.ListeningListening Comprehension20-- 30 minutesComprehending announcements, news, and daily conversations.ComposingComposed Expression30 minutesComposing a semi-formal or formal letter/email based upon specific prompts.Checking Out Comprehension Detail
This area consists of 3 parts. Prospects need to match headlines to texts, response multiple-choice questions based on a longer article, and discover specific info in other words advertisements. The "Language Elements" part (typically described as the grammar part) checks the prospect's capability to pick the correct word or grammatical structure in a cloze text (fill-in-the-blanks).
Listening Comprehension Detail
The listening area uses audio recordings of various lengths. Prospects should identify if statements hold true or false or select the proper answer from several alternatives. These recordings show real-life situations, such as train station announcements or radio interviews.
Composing Detail
Candidates are typically provided a circumstance (e.g., responding to an invitation, grumbling about a service, or asking for information). They should write a coherent text of approximately 80-- 100 words. Accuracy, structure, and the appropriate use of formal or informal registers are crucial grading requirements.
2. The Oral Examination
The oral test normally happens after the written part and is conducted in pairs (two candidates and two inspectors). It lasts approximately 15 minutes, with an extra 20 minutes supplied ahead of time for preparation.

To pass the Telc B1 Zertifikat Online test, a candidate needs to achieve a minimum of 60% of the optimum possible points in both the composed and the oral sections. This equates to 135 points in the composed part and 45 points in the oral part.

The length of time is the Telc B1 certificate valid?
The Telc B1 Sprachzertifikat certificate has limitless credibility. It does not expire. Nevertheless, some institutions or companies might request a certificate that disappears than two years old to make sure that the person's current language skills are still at that level.
2. Can one retake the examination if they fail?
Yes, the exam can be retaken as often times as needed. If a candidate passes just one part (either the written or the oral), they may have the ability to rollover that result to a future exam date within a particular timeframe (normally until completion of the next calendar year), suggesting they just need to retake the part they failed.
3. For how long does it require to get the results?
Typically, it takes in between four to 6 weeks for Telc to process the examinations and send out the results to the screening center. Candidates need to plan appropriately if they have strict due dates for visa or job applications.
4. Is Telc B1 more difficult than Goethe B1?
Both examinations follow CEFR requirements, so the difficulty level of the language is the very same. However, the format varies. For instance, the Goethe B1 Prüfung Online Mit Zertifikat test is modular (meaning you can take and pass the four modules individually), whereas Telc divides it into a written block and an oral block.
5. What materials are permitted throughout the exam?
No dictionaries, phones, or external notes are allowed during the composed or oral areas. Just pens and the supplied assessment papers are permitted.
